The Microbial Imaging Facility (MIF) is located within PC2 laboratories which allows analysis of both Class 2 pathogens and genetically modified organism (GMOs). Cell culture and pathogen preparation rooms are also available.

Available instruments

  • Nikon Ti inverted epifluorescent microscope with phase contrast and DIC objectives, CCD and EMCCD cameras and live cell imaging capability (humidified environmental chamber with temperature and CO2 (control) with Perfect Focus System ™.

    Filter Cubes: mCherry (HC Red), GFP B, YFP HQ, Texas Red, Cy5.5, DAPI, UV-2A, GFP HQ, TRITC

  • Nikon A1 laser scanning confocal microscope with MadCity ultra-fast piezo Z-drive, filter and spectral detection, phase contrast and DIC objectives, galvano and resonance scanners and live cell imaging capability (humidified environmental chamber with temperature and CO2 (control) with Perfect Focus System ™.

    Lasers: 404, 488, 561, 637 nm
    Emission: blue (425-475 nm), green (500 - 550 nm), red (570-620 nm), far red (662-737 nm)

  • DeltaVision personalDV high resolution imaging system (inverted epifluorescent deconvolution microscope)

    Filter Cubes: DAPI, TRITC, FITC, Cy5

  • DeltaVision personalDV high resolution imaging system (inverted epifluorescent deconvolution microscope) fitted with a WeatherStation environmental control chamber.

    Light sources: 405, 488, 514 and 593 nm lasers and LED-illuminated DIC
    Emission Filters: DAPI (405 EX / 419-465 EM), CFP (405 EX / 464.5-499.5 EM), Alexa488, EGFP (488 EX / 500-550 EM), YFP (514 EX / 500-507, 523.8-550 EM), Alexa594 (592.5 EX / 608-648 EM), mCherry (592.5 nm EX / 602.5-655.5 EM)

  • DeltaVision OMX Blaze ™ microscope for multi-wavelength simultaneous fast structured illumination imaging or fast simultaneous multi-wavelength high resolution deconvolution live cell imaging, with heated stage.

    Light sources: 405, 488, 514 and 593 nm lasers and LED-illuminated DIC
    Emission Filters: DAPI (405 EX / 419-465 EM), CFP (405 EX / 464.5-499.5 EM), Alexa488, EGFP (488 EX / 500-550 EM), YFP (514 EX / 500-507, 523.8-550 EM), Alexa594 (592.5 EX / 608-648 EM), mCherry (592.5 nm EX / 602.5-655.5 EM)

  • BD LSRII analytical flow cytometer with 4 lasers and 11 detection filters -

    Lasers: 325, 405, 488, 635 nm
    Emission Filters: Indo1 (blue), DAPI, Hoechst 33258, Indo-1 (Violet), FRET-YFP, Pacific orange, Pacific blue, CFP, PE-Cy5, PerCP, PerCP-Cy5.5, PE, PE-Cy7, PE-Texas Red, Alexa488, FITC, GFP, APC-Cy7, APC, Alexa700

  • Advanced computing capabilities Additional computing resources are available within the Advanced Computing Facility (ACF) of MIF. The ACF is located on the same floor as the MIF outside of the wet labs and is designed for offline image and data analysis.

    • Image analysis software: NIS Elements, Bitplane IMARIS, SIS AnalySIS, ImageJ
    • Flow Cytometry analysis software: Diva, FCAP Array, FlowJo, Modfit and CellQuest Pro
    • Other software: Adobe Photoshop, Graphpad PRISM, Accelrys MacVector
  • OptIPortal: so named for its use of optical networking, Internet protocol, computer storage, processing and visualization technologies. The goal of the OptIPortal is to enable scientists who are generating large data sets to interactively visualise, analyse and correlate their data from multiple storage sites connected to optical networks. UTS has installed 2 OptIPuters to support data intensive research and collaboration- one of these is located within the Advanced Computing Facility.

Additional optical imaging equipment

  • Olympus BX51 upright epifluorescence microscope with DIC objectives and DP70 CCD camera

    Filter Cubes: TRITC wide, UV/DAPI wide, YFP, FITC wide, FITC narrow

  • Olympus BX51 upright epifluorescence microscope and DP70 CCD camera

    Filter Cubes: UV/DAPI narrow, FITC wide, TRITC narrow, TRITC wide, TEXAS RED

  • Olympus BX60 upright epifluorescence microscope with phase contrast objectives and CCD camera

    Filter Cubes: UV/DAPI, FITC wide, automatic overlay functionality

  • BD FACScalibur analytical flow cytometer with 2 lasers and 6 detection filters

    Lasers: 405, 488 nm
    Emission Filters: APC-Cy7, APC, PE-Cy7, PerCP, PE, FITC, GFP, Alexa488

  • Culture facilities for primary cell lines, established cell lines, host/pathogen interaction, biofilms, bacteriology, virology, parasitology, warm room (37°), shaking incubators, variable temp incubators, controlled atmosphere incubators
